Moncler Gamme Bleu Sunglasses for Spring/Summer 2010

29 April 2010, 19.00 | Posted in Accessories | 2 comments »

Selectism - Moncler Gamme Bleu Sunglasses for Spring/Summer 2010

HS covers an awesome pair of goggles that remind me of the time traveler spotted in that photo from the 40’s. “They came from nowhere and have pretty much stormed the fashion market in recent years. A brand that was exclusively known for their premium down jackets, is step by step entering every category of the luxury market. We especially like their Thom Browne designed Gamme Bleu collection. As part of the collection, Moncler introduces for Spring/Summer 2010 their first sunglasses. The frame slightly reminds us of Moscot, while the leather pieces remind you of the ski heritage and the 3-stripe strap is of course clearly the Thom Browne signature.”
